iOS Notification Behavior
Apple’s ecosystem provides users granular control, but it also brings the concept of “time‑sensitive” interruptions that bypass Focus modes. Our app utilizes this classification carefully, allocating it only to withdrawal statuses, account security events and VIP tournament deadlines that have a hard cut‑off. Regular bonus alerts use standard delivery, which honors your Sleep and Work Focus settings without pushing themselves onto the screen.

Android’s Notification Channels
Android structures every app’s alerts into channels, which act as self‑contained pipes. Slotsdj Casino creates a dedicated channel for each category as soon as the app launches. This means you can long‑press any notification that you find distracting, tap “manage,” and jump directly into that specific channel’s behaviour, adjusting importance, sound and visibility without disrupting the other categories.
Managing Priority and Category Settings
We advise keeping withdrawal and security channels at “High” priority so they produce heads‑up pop‑ups regardless of what you’re doing. Promotional channels work best at “Medium,” which delivers them silently to the shade and lets you review them at your leisure. Android also supports notification snoozing; you can swipe a tournament reminder away and have it return 30 minutes later, which is incredibly handy when you’re in the middle of a session and want to finish a few more spins before registering.
